Events. Summer Corpus Intensive

On 26–29 May 2026 in Paris (France), an intensive summer school “Corpus Methods in Linguistics–Compilation, Annotation, and Quantitative Analysis” will take place.

This intensive, week-long course (30 academic hours) will consist of the following structure:

  • ● Morning sessions will focus on data collection, extraction, and organisation, along with DIY corpus building.
  • ● Afternoon sessions will concentrate on the statistical analysis of the data generated in the morning sessions.
  • ● Several half-day sessions will address automatic annotation and manual annotation methods.

Participants in the summer school will acquire the following skills:

  • ● How to formulate advanced search queries in a concordancer (such as TextSTAT, AntConc);
  • ● How to compile a text corpus with BootCaT;
  • ● How to automatically annotate a text corpus in TreeTagger;
  • ● How to measure keyword specificity and collocation strength using AntConc;
  • ● How to perform statistical analyses of categorical variables in R.

This program is primarily designed for researchers and upper-level students (Master’s or PhD). The tuition fee is set at 90€. It is important to note that this is an international summer school, and activities will involve working with corpora in English, French, and potentially other languages. While knowledge of French is advantageous, it is not mandatory.
